If your company uses a database application based on any of such popular systems as Clipper, dBase, FoxPro and their "Visual" clones, you have a lot of files in the DBF format. Your everyday administration tasks probably include backing up your DBF files, synchronizing them between computers or offices, converting them to other formats, publishing on the web and more... When managing DBF files, you often need to take a quick look at their contents. Starting your database application, and finding the necessary data is not the easiest way to do this. Moreover, from a database application GUI, it is normally not clear what data is contained in each particular DBF file. Administrators usually prefer to use a simple DBF viewer for this purpose. Before you buy a DBF viewer with only very basic features, you may want to consider a product from HiBase Group called DBF Viewer 2000. For the very same price, you'll receive an all-purpose Swiss Army Knife for your DBF files. First of all, it's a quick and handy DBF viewer that features a modern multi-document tabbed interface. It includes all you'll need for comfortable DBF browsing. In addition, the program provides full editing capabilities. You can edit or manage records as well as the table structure. DBF Viewer 2000 dynamically builds visual dialogs according to the DBF file structure. These dialogs allow you to edit records naturally as if you were using your database application. There are many advanced editing features including textual fields formatting and automated removal of duplicate records. Advanced filtering and searching. Printing. Converting data to a range of popular formats (Excel, XML, SQL, TXT, CSV, RTF). Importing from csv, excel files to dbf files. Generating web-ready HTML output. Data preview in the Open File dialog. Command line interface for use in batch operations. All these features and more make DBF Viewer 2000 an unparalleled DBF managing tool.

DBF Viewer 2000 features and specs

  • Lightweight and Fast
    DBF Viewer 2000 is a small, portable application that loads and displays DBF files quickly without requiring heavy system resources, making it efficient for basic tasks.
  • Simple Interface
    The program offers a straightforward, easy-to-navigate interface that allows users to quickly view and browse DBF file contents without a steep learning curve.
  • No Installation Required
    The software can run as a portable executable, allowing users to use it directly from a USB drive or folder without installing it on a system.
  • Supports Multiple DBF Formats
    It supports various dBASE file formats (III, IV, FoxPro, etc.), providing compatibility with older legacy database files.
  • Export Capabilities
    Users can export DBF data to other formats like CSV, XLS, or HTML, which is helpful for integrating legacy data into modern applications.
